Easy to transport

If you're planning to go for a ride, or taking public transportation, it's essential to have a wheelchair that is simple to transport. Folding power wheelchairs are typically smaller and lighter than mobility scooters, making them easy to fit into a trunk of a vehicle without the need for lifts. You can maintain your independence and travel wherever you like without worrying about finding a cab or waiting for someone to pick you up with an automobile.

Moreover the folding electric wheelchair is also easier to store, which can be especially beneficial if you don't have lots of living space. The chairs can be folded down to the size of a small space and have their accessories removed to save space. This makes them a good choice for people who live in tiny homes or have a limited storage space. The ability to fold the chair helps reduce the stress on caregivers as well as other people who need to lift it, which could lead to injuries.

In addition to their foldability In addition, a lot of these wheelchairs come with built-in features that help you navigate in restricted spaces. They are designed to fit through doorways, narrow hallways and other obstacles that might be difficult for other wheelchairs. Some models come with an extremely compact steering system as well as electronic controls, which makes them suitable for those who are unable to operate manual controls.

Before making a decision, it is important to compare wheelchairs and understand their engineering and construction. This involves recognizing the differences between rigid and folding frames. Although they appear similar from afar small design elements can have a significant impact on performance. For instance, the dimensions and style of side frames, cross braces and hardware used to connect components can differ among models. This could affect the weight and stiffness.

Another thing to think about is the degree of customization that can be achieved on the wheelchair. This is an area in which rigid wheelchairs be a step ahead of folding wheelchairs because they can adjust more precisely to a person's preferences. For example rigid wheelchairs provide an array of increments in front-end hanger angles, back angles, and camber.
